1. The Right Qualifications
Roofing contractors should be properly trained and should have plenty of experience working in the industry. The best roofers can put their experience and training to work for homeowners, helping them decide how best to address issues with their roofs.
After evaluating your roof, they will sit down with you to talk about the project, discussing any issues that may affect how long the work takes to complete. They will also discuss different roofing materials with you, making recommendations based on the structure of your home, the area where you live, and the angle of your roof. Anytime you hire a roofing contractor, ask them about their credentials to make sure they are qualified for the job.
2. A Local Address
Choose a roofing company that is based in your local area. Hiring a roofing company that is located close to home makes sense for a lot of reasons. For one thing, they know what the weather is like in your area, which means that they can make better recommendations regarding your material choices. If you have any issues with your roof after it is repaired or replaced, you can also easily get in touch with them to discuss the problem.
3. A Professional Approach
The best roofers take their jobs seriously, always using a professional approach when working on projects for their clients. Not only does that mean that they show up on time but they also are willing to discuss any questions or concerns that homeowners may have. By choosing a roofing company that prioritizes customer service, you can be sure that you will be treated honestly and respectfully throughout the entire roofing project.
4. An Excellent Reputation
Before hiring Charlotte roofers, ask around to see if anyone else has used the same company before. Your friends, family members, or neighbors may have experience working with a particular roofing company, which can give you some valuable insight into how they work. Contact a roofing professional nearby to get your roofing projects done well.